
Kinel experiences a humid continental climate with cold, snowy winters and warm, sometimes hot summers. Average annual temperature is around 6°C (43°F), with January lows reaching -15°C (5°F) and highs of -8°C (18°F), while July brings highs of 26°C (79°F) and lows of 14°C (57°F). Precipitation totals about 480 mm yearly, mostly as summer rain and winter snow. Extremes include winter drops to -35°C (-31°F) and summer peaks near 38°C (100°F). Spring (March-May) sees temperatures rising from 0°C (32°F) to 17°C (63°F) with melting snow and occasional floods. Summer (June-August) is mild to warm at 20-26°C (68-79°F), ideal for outdoor agricultural studies but with thunderstorms. Fall (September-November) cools to 10°C (50°F) with rain, and winter (December-February) brings heavy snow and -10°C (14°F) averages, requiring heated dorms. At 70m altitude, Kinel sits on the East European Plain with flat geology, no volcanoes. Air quality is moderate (AQI 40-70), affected by nearby Samara industry but better than urban centers. PM2.5 averages 15 µg/m³ yearly. Green spaces aid health, though pollen in spring impacts allergies. Samara State Agricultural Academy promotes eco-initiatives. Kinel faces floods from the Samara River (every 5-10 years), extreme cold snaps, and summer droughts. Snowstorms disrupt transport 10-15 days yearly. No major earthquakes or fires.
